The Ashmolean Museum is a part of Oxford University and it houses the University’s collections of art and archaeology. The collections themselves are of world significance. They range from archaeology to the fine and decorative arts of Europe and Asia. Above all, the Ashmolean is a great public Museum, open to all without charge. The Museum completed its redevelopment in November 2009 to deliver 39 new permanent galleries together with new temporary exhibition galleries, study and teaching facilities, conservation studios and significantly enhanced visitor facilities, including Oxford’s first roof-top restaurant. The redevelopment has received huge critical and public acclaim, evidenced by the very significant number of visitors to the Museum since its reopening, anticipated to exceed 1 million in the first year of operation.
